Christina Filippou is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Physiology and Nutrition and Dietet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Christina Filippou has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 395 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 8 papers in Physiology and 6 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ics. Recurrent topics in Christina Filippou’s work include Nutritional Studies and Diet (10 papers), Diet and metabolism studies (8 papers) and Sodium Intake and Health (6 papers). Christina Filippou is often cited by papers focused on Nutritional Studies and Diet (10 papers), Diet and metabolism studies (8 papers) and Sodium Intake and Health (6 papers). Christina Filippou collaborates with scholars based in Greece, Norway and Australia. Christina Filippou's co-authors include Costas Thomopoulos, Petros Nihoyannopoulos, Dimitrios Tousoulis, Costas Tsioufis, Lida Sotiropoulou, Christina Chrysochoou, Kyriakos Dimitriadis, Costas Mihas, Konstantinos Tsioufis and Yannis Μanios and has published in prestigious journals such as European Heart Journal, Journal of Hypertension and Clinical Nutrition.
